Brewing Tips

Overview

Temperature: 198°F

Ratio: 1:16

Grind Size: Medium-Coarse
80 Clicks on Kingrinder K6

Recommendations

This coffee reaches ideal flavor expression after 1 week of rest. Please brew between 7 days – 12 weeks after roast date for best results.

Roasted just dark enough for a bold and balanced espresso, this versatile coffee can be enjoyed as an espresso or your preferred filter coffee method.

V60 Recipe

We recommend a low-agitation recipe for this coffee for a smooth balance between body and sweetness.
18g Coffee : 288g Water
0:00
Bloom – 60g
0:40
Gentle Spiral Pour to 190g
1:30
Center Pour or Gentle Circular Pour to 288g
Total Drawdown Time: 2:20 – 2:40
